"Phylis!" Xelloss exclaimed, grinning in a friendly manner. "Shall we play a game?"
Phylis clutched her doll tightly and looked up.
Slatted Violet eyes met slatted blue eyes.
"Sure Mr.... Mr....Um... Whats your name again mister?"
As the Mazoku glanced at Filia, she Felt that he was pleading with her.
"Phylis." Filia said. "This is... daddy."
"his eyes are the same as mine." Phylis pointed out eventually and she handed Xelloss her precious dolly. "Look after. I get another one."
Xelloss stared suprised at Filia as the child bounced off to her room.
"what?" Filia asked. "I don't know what you'd do if I hadn't told her."
"Point taken. In that case, my dear Filia...." He smiled as she shuddered. "I wish to spend some time with her."
Phylis bounded into the room holding a few dolls in a little box.
"We play tea time!" She announced skipping outside, "Come on Mr Daddy!"
"Jaa Filia." Xelloss said with a smirk, following Phylis, leaving Filia sitting and watching them warily.
"Where is Eros?" Filia growled to herself, resisting the urge to get up and destroy what she could see.
"They're all upside down!" Phylis giggled. "Suzy's got a headache!"
"Maybe a swim would help?" Xelloss suggested sending that doll flying into the stream.
Phylis Clapped and giggled.
"Suzzzzy Swiiiiiiiiiming! Lookit! Sarah's on fire!" She shrieked throwing another doll in to the stream. Now it was Xelloss' turn to applaud.
Filia sniffed the air. Then remembered, her and Phylis had been baking cakes. Quick as a flash, Filia ran in to tackle the blackened cakes.
And the Mazoku took his chance.
Xelloss picked up his staff.
Took aim.
Phylis looked up at her new playmate with adoration.
He fired.
Juu-ou was quite impressed by what she saw before her. Eros was two thirds mazoku, and one third golden dragon.
She was also revelling in the success of her plan. Such combinations had been thought impossible until now.
"This calls for a celebratory drink." She murmered smoothly to herself. "What is this?" she added, her lips curled in amusement. "Defiance? No? What do you call it then?"
Eros looked around for who she was talking to. His big dark eyes taking notice of every creature around. None of them were responding to Zelas.
"Who are you talking to?" Eros piped up, approaching her boldly.
"Curiosity? What interesting terminology." She narrowed her eyes and stared piercingly into her drink, after a short pause and a satified smile. "Do what you like then."
"OY! Who are you talking to!?" Eros asked loudly, tugging at Zelas' robes.
She was a little taken aback to be spoken to like that, but that raised her opinion of Eros a little more.
She gave herself another mental pat on the back. She'd done most of this on the spur of the moment. But everything had worked out as she wanted.
Xelloss asked her if he could try being human. She said no. Then later granted his wish by surprise, expecting he'd hate it and beg to return.
A human Xelloss was more resilliant than she could ever plan for. Then a quick calculation in her head added Filia to the equation.
What ever human-ness the children inherited, they got it from Xelloss.
And Zelas didn't hesititate in taking that away either.
The results were plain to see in Eros.
And pleasing too.
She shipped Eros off with a couple of lower minions, on the orders to have a little fun and encourage his destructive personality. Then she turned her attention back to her high servant, more for her own entertainment that anything else.
A flicker of anger. How delightful.
Zelas knew she could brush those thoughts and feelings out of his head effortlessly, but she also enjoyed watching.
It was so much more satisfying to control than be blindly obeyed.
